Our Sutton Suit Jacket offers a spin on a tailored sports coat; if you’re looking for a suit that doesn’t feel like a suit, you’ve found it. It’s crafted from an Italian gabardine, a type of twill worsted wool first introduced in the late 19th century. Lightweight, breathable and durable, our take is a transitional weight 4-ply wool with perfect drape. This two-button jacket features design details like a partial, lightweight lining and pick-stitching at the lapel, which gives it a handmade feel. The overall effect is clean and tailored, refined, but still easy-wearing. Wear this with the matching Sutton Suit Pants to the office, or pair it with denim and a tee or sweatshirt for a smart weekend look.
